Washington City Services stripes and numbers parking stalls for municipal lots, garages, and facility parking, including reserved and permit-designated spaces. We lay out stall dimensions and drive aisles to your specifications and mark ADA-accessible stalls with the access aisle, symbol, and signage the ADA and Washington accessibility code require. Numbering and stenciling use durable traffic paint suited to the surface and expected wear. Layouts can incorporate EV, loading, and staff-reserved designations as your facility needs evolve.
Maximizes usable capacity through efficient stall layout; delivers ADA-compliant accessible stalls and access aisles; provides clear numbering for permit and enforcement programs; accommodates EV, loading, and reserved designations
1) Measure the lot and plan stall and aisle dimensions; 2) Lay out standard, accessible, and reserved spaces; 3) Stripe stalls and apply numbers, symbols, and legends; 4) Verify ADA dimensions and install accompanying signage
Number of stalls and total lot area; proportion of ADA and specialty designations; surface condition and paint type; layout changes from an existing configuration; traffic control and lot-closure scheduling
Striping and stenciling are scheduled in dry weather, making late spring through early fall the most dependable window.
